Transaction ecfffb8f664043f43bd05369b18c2a7cf7a5c60db5a22c62b010c5018aa1d4da

block
3dc51804837111ab289a256e7a95cd8247566c4c4fab624e5b811dfb346e8dc9

6 Inputs

1 Output